Output 7c23b462348a10347a8616ab4b9ee227a564ebccbed33f1f54c7a5ff5e9b085b:0

value
14338874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b8735b35664a6209b151fe147e64e88ab2840a OP_EQUAL
address
3PYYPF88vNXW8T93yhJ9SFt93pRgMHovLy
transaction
7c23b462348a10347a8616ab4b9ee227a564ebccbed33f1f54c7a5ff5e9b085b
confirmations
373380
spent
true